At Christmas Holy Cross Parish has 6 masses to choose from. Here is our schedule:
Christmas Eve:
4:00 p.m Mass in the Gym[all other Masses are in the Church]
4:00 p.m. Mass in the Church
6:00 p.m. Mass
12:00 Midnight Mass
Christmas Day:
7:30 Mass
9:15 Mass
I would like to encourage people to attend Midnight Mass. Many people like to go to 4:00 Mass before their evening with family and friends, however, the 4:00 Masses are very full-- large crowds, difficulty parking, Mass in a gym. There is a dynamic excitement that comes with the crowd, but many people do not find it very prayerful. At Midnight Mass, you are coming after a night with family and friends. Gathering at that time of night is very specially, and very traditional. The Music will be very beautiful. As we pray in the middle of the night we have a special insight into what Mary and Joseph were experiencing in the middle of the night 2000 years ago.
I hope all of you have a wonderful Christmas Season, and hopefully that will begin with a wonderful experience of Mass.
